2012 MVR to CRC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the MVR to CRC ex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on July 1, valuing the pair at 36.4891.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on October 15, dropping to 32.0153.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 4.4738 CRC.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 36.0285 to the December average rate of 32.6032, the exchange rate registered a net change of -9.51%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 36.4891 was down 8.47% compared to the 2011 peak of 39.8644,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
